First Down: The Streaming Superstars
These are the big guns, the apps designed specifically to beam live sports directly into your palm. Think ESPN+, NFL+ (if you're local to the game or it's a primetime matchup), or even bigger platforms like Hulu + Live TV or YouTube TV.

They usually cost a monthly fee, but imagine that feeling of pure, unadulterated joy as you watch Patrick Mahomes sling a touchdown pass while waiting in line at the grocery store. Priceless, I tell you!
Before you commit, most of these offer free trials! Take them for a spin and see if they fit your needs. It's like test-driving a brand new, super-fast mobile experience.

Second Down: The Network Apps
This one's a little trickier, but it can be a lifesaver. If the game is airing on, say, CBS, check out the CBS app. Many network apps let you stream their live broadcast, but here's the catch: you usually need a cable or satellite subscription to verify your identity.
Basically, they want to make sure you're already paying for the channel somewhere else before they let you watch on your phone. It's like showing your ID at the coolest club in town – you gotta prove you're worthy!

Third Down: The Sneaky Free Options (Use with Caution!)
Alright, let's be real. There are always websites and apps floating around that promise free streams. These are the deep routes, the Hail Marys of mobile viewing.
However, approach these with extreme caution. They're often riddled with ads that pop up like mischievous gremlins, and the video quality can be... questionable. Picture watching the game through a potato.
Plus, some of these sites aren't exactly on the up-and-up. You might accidentally download something nasty onto your phone, which is definitely not what you want before kickoff. So, use at your own risk, friend!

Fourth Down: Game Day Prep!
Okay, you've chosen your weapon. Now, let's get you prepared for the battlefield! First, make sure your phone is fully charged. A dead battery during a crucial play is a tragedy of epic proportions.
Next, find a solid Wi-Fi connection. Streaming video eats data like Travis Kelce eats touchdowns. You don't want to blow through your entire monthly allowance in the first quarter.
